Embracing innovation and precision in the battle against breast cancer, Merit Medical Systems celebrates the use of its SCOUT Radar Localization technology, marking a significant milestone with its application on 750,000 patients globally. This achievement aligns with Breast Cancer Awareness Month, reinforcing the importance of early detection and advanced treatment options. The SCOUT system, renowned for its wire-free localization technology, implements radar technology to enhance the accuracy of surgical interventions while minimizing trauma to healthy tissues, effectively revolutionizing the patient care process.
Precision and Patient Care
The SCOUT Locator, by embedding a minuscule, rice-sized reflector, empowers surgeons to target abnormal breast tissue with impressive precision, achieving an accuracy within +/- 1mm. This accuracy ensures a higher success rate for surgeries, maximizing the potential for improved patient outcomes. Further expanding its utility, SCOUT is adaptable for a variety of procedures, including pre- and post-neoadjuvant chemotherapy and tissue bracketing, thereby enhancing its versatility in oncological care.
Global Reach and Advancements
With a presence in over 50 countries and usage in more than 1,100 facilities worldwide, SCOUT’s reputation as a trusted solution in breast cancer treatment is well-established. The recent introduction of SCOUT MD to Merit’s portfolio exemplifies the commitment to advancing surgical precision. This next-generation system, with its unique radar signals, enables more precise mapping of tumors and lesions, supporting a comprehensive approach to cancer localization and removal.
